home *** CD-ROM | disk | FTP | other *** search
Makefile | 1990-02-28 | 2.6 KB | 98 lines |
- #
- # Makefile for MMDF general utility routines
- #
- MODULES = tty_io ll_err ll_log tai_packages cmdsrch \
- cmdbsrch cnvtdate creatdir getfpath getwho \
- arg2str str2arg cstr2arg gpwlnam ggrlnam \
- strindex equwrd equal endstr initstr lexrel \
- prefix strequ lexequ chrcnv getutmp getgroup \
- compress multcpy multcat strdup gcread gettys \
- zero blt expand sstr2arg nexec \
- tai_file tai_noop \
- gwdir gwdir.4.2 \
- getllog.v7 getllog.bsd getllog.fak
-
- STANDARD = tty_io.o ll_err.o ll_log.o tai_packages.o cmdsrch.o \
- cmdbsrch.o cnvtdate.o creatdir.o getfpath.o getwho.o \
- arg2str.o str2arg.o cstr2arg.o gpwlnam.o ggrlnam.o \
- strindex.o equwrd.o equal.o endstr.o initstr.o lexrel.o \
- prefix.o strequ.o lexequ.o chrcnv.o getutmp.o getgroup.o \
- compress.o multcpy.o multcat.o strdup.o gcread.o gettys.o \
- zero.o blt.o expand.o sstr2arg.o nexec.o
-
- STDSRCS = tty_io.c ll_err.c ll_log.c tai_packages.c cmdsrch.c \
- cmdbsrch.o cnvtdate.c creatdir.c getfpath.c getwho.c \
- arg2str.c str2arg.c cstr2arg.c gpwlnam.c ggrlnam.c \
- strindex.c equwrd.c equal.c endstr.c initstr.c lexrel.c \
- prefix.c strequ.c lexequ.c chrcnv.c getutmp.c getgroup.c \
- compress.c multcpy.c multcat.c strdup.c gcread.c gettys.c \
- zero.c blt.c expand.c sstr2arg.c nexec.c
-
- v7objs = getllog.v7.o gwdir.o
- v7srcs = getllog.v7.c gwdir.c
-
- 5.2objs = getllog.fak.o gwdir.o
- 5.2srcs = getllog.fak.c gwdir.c
-
- 4.1objs = getllog.bsd.o gwdir.o
- 4.1srcs = getllog.bsd.c gwdir.c
-
- 4.2objs = getllog.bsd.o gwdir.4.2.o
- 4.2srcs = getllog.bsd.c gwdir.4.2.c
-
- 4.3objs = getllog.bsd.o gwdir.4.2.o
- 4.3srcs = getllog.bsd.c gwdir.4.2.c
-
- real-default: ../util-made
- ../util-made: ${STANDARD} ${LOCALUTIL} ../${SYSTEM}-made
- ar r ../libmmdf.a ${STANDARD} ${LOCALUTIL}
- -touch ../util-made
-
- ../v7-made: ${v7objs}
- ar r ../libmmdf.a ${v7objs}
- -touch ../v7-made
-
- ../5.2-made: ${5.2objs}
- ar r ../libmmdf.a ${5.2objs}
- -touch ../5.2-made
-
- ../4.1-made: ${4.1objs}
- ar r ../libmmdf.a ${4.1objs}
- -touch ../4.1-made
-
- ../4.2-made: ${4.2objs}
- ar r ../libmmdf.a ${4.2objs}
- -touch ../4.2-made
-
- ../4.3-made: ${4.3objs}
- ar r ../libmmdf.a ${4.3objs}
- -touch ../4.3-made
-
- lint: std-lint ${SYSTEM}-lint
- cat llib-lutila* llib-lutilb* > llib-lutil.ln
-
- std-lint:
- $(LINT) -Cutila $(LFLAGS) $(STDSRCS)
-
- v7-lint:
- $(LINT) -Cutilb $(LFLAGS) $(v7srcs)
-
- 5.2-lint:
- $(LINT) -Cutilb $(LFLAGS) $(5.2srcs)
-
- 4.1-lint:
- $(LINT) -Cutilb $(LFLAGS) $(4.1srcs)
-
- 4.2-lint:
- $(LINT) -Cutilb $(LFLAGS) $(4.2srcs)
-
- 4.3-lint:
- $(LINT) -Cutilb $(LFLAGS) $(4.3srcs)
-
- clean:
- -rm -f *.o x.c makedep eddep make.out errs core llib-lutil*
-
-
- # DO NOT DELETE THIS LINE -- make depend uses it
-
-